Cultural Fusion

Within the vibrant heart of a nation like the United States, a phenomenon unfolds - a beautiful blending of cultures. Each person, carrying their own diverse heritage, adds to this remarkable composition. From the vibrant streets of New York City to the tranquil countryside, stories of migration and integration are woven into the very structure of society. This dynamic tapestry of cultures is a reminder to the power that comes from variation.

Shattered Along : Political Polarization in America

The American landscape is fractured, a nation where political beliefs clash with increasing acrimony. The two-party system, once a structure for debate, has become a arena of ideological warfare. Citizens find themselves increasingly isolated within virtual enclaves, where alternative facts run rampant and unity seems an unattainable objective. This rift threatens the very essence of American democracy, casting a shadow over its destiny.

From Silicon Valley to Wall Street: The US Economic Landscape

The U.S. economy is a complex and dynamic system, constantly shifting. Traditionally, the epicenter of financial power was located on the New York Stock Exchange. However, in recent decades, Silicon Valley has emerged as a influential force, driving innovation and technology. This convergence of finance and technology creates both opportunities for the American economy.

  • Major factor of this dynamic is the rise of digital finance, which blends financial services with code. This field has revolutionized traditional banking and created new business models for growth.
  • Furthermore, Silicon Valley's emphasis on invention has led to the development of new technologies that have effects across various sectors, including finance. This fusion of ideas and expertise is advantageous for the overall health of the American economy.

However, there are also potential risks associated with this merger. For example, the centralization of power in a few large tech companies could restrict competition and innovation. Moreover, regulatory frameworks may struggle to keep pace with the rapid evolution of technology, leading to unintended results.
